1. The Listicle Format for Engagement

I’ve discovered that titles like “Top 10 Tips for Better Photography” instantly grab attention because they promise a quick, organized value. I recommend using numbers because they stand out in feeds and set clear expectations. When I tried this format, my click rate improved dramatically, proving that youtube title examples that work often leverage listicles for instant clarity and curiosity.

2. The Curiosity Gap Approach

From my experience, titles that create a curiosity gap—such as “You Won’t Believe What Happened Next”—generate high engagement. I’ve found that teasing just enough information makes viewers eager to click. I recommend experimenting with this approach for your niche, as it taps into viewers’ natural desire to satisfy their curiosity, making youtube title examples that work highly effective.

3. The How-To Titles That Promise Solutions

I’ve tested many “How to” titles like “How to Grow Your YouTube Channel Fast,” which clearly state the benefit. I believe these titles attract viewers actively seeking solutions. When I craft titles with this format, I focus on specific, attainable results, ensuring my audience feels compelled to click and learn more. This is a proven youtube title examples that work that I swear by.

4. The Emotional Trigger Titles

In my experience, adding emotional words like “Amazing,” “Unbelievable,” or “Heartwarming” can evoke strong reactions. For example, “An Unbelievable Transformation” appeals to viewers’ emotions. I recommend using emotional triggers thoughtfully, as they can significantly boost your video’s appeal—another youtube title examples that work method I rely on.

Avoid Clickbait—Be Honest

From what I’ve learned, misleading titles might get clicks initially but can harm your channel’s credibility long-term. I recommend being honest and transparent about your content while still making your titles intriguing. This balance helps build trust, and I believe that trustworthy youtube title examples that work contribute to sustained growth.

Common Mistakes to Avoid with Your youtube title examples that work

Overstuffing Keywords

I’ve made the mistake of cramming too many keywords into my titles, which often made them awkward and less appealing. I recommend focusing on one or two primary keywords and making the title natural and engaging. From what I’ve learned, overstuffing can hurt both your SEO and viewer perception—so keep it simple and effective.

Using Vague Titles

Vague titles like “My Video” or “Check This Out” rarely attract viewers. I believe clarity is key, so I always aim to make my titles specific and descriptive. When I do this, I notice a noticeable increase in clicks because viewers immediately understand what they’ll get.
